Pre-Production Planning

Thorough pre-production planning is crucial for successful industrial photography. Begin by researching the specific industry and location. Understand the processes, machinery, and potential visual narratives. Develop a shot list outlining desired images and angles. Crucially, coordinate schedules with the facility and personnel, ensuring minimal disruption to operations. Scouting the location beforehand allows you to identify ideal vantage points, assess lighting conditions, and anticipate potential challenges. This preparation ensures efficient and effective execution of the shoot.

Lighting Techniques for Industrial Environments

Mastering lighting is paramount in industrial photography. The often challenging conditions within industrial settings—vast spaces, complex machinery, and varying light sources—demand a thorough understanding of lighting techniques to effectively capture the scene and convey the desired mood.

Existing light can be a powerful tool. Harness the dramatic interplay of natural light filtering through grimy windows or the ambient glow of machinery. Observe how these light sources shape the scene and create natural highlights and shadows. Using a fast lens and adjusting your ISO can help you capture these nuances effectively. However, relying solely on available light may not always suffice. Often, supplemental lighting is necessary to control the mood and highlight specific details.

Strategic use of strobes and flashes allows you to overcome limitations of ambient light. Position your strobes to sculpt the light, creating depth and dimension. Bouncing light off reflective surfaces can soften harsh shadows and create a more even illumination. Experiment with different angles and power settings to achieve the desired effect. Light modifiers, such as softboxes and umbrellas, can further diffuse the light and minimize harsh shadows, resulting in a more polished and professional look.

Consider the color temperature of your light sources. Mixing different color temperatures, such as the warm glow of incandescent bulbs and the cool tones of ambient light, can create interesting visual effects. However, be mindful of maintaining consistency and avoiding clashes that distract from the overall image. Using gels on your strobes can help you match the color temperature of different light sources or create specific color effects, adding a stylistic touch to your photographs.

When shooting in hazardous environments, prioritize safety and choose lighting equipment that is appropriately rated for the specific conditions. Consider using battery-powered strobes for portability and ease of use. Remember that lighting in industrial settings can be complex and requires careful planning and execution. Experimentation is key to finding the right balance and achieving the desired aesthetic. By understanding and utilizing various lighting techniques, you can transform challenging industrial environments into compelling visual narratives.

Safety should always be the top priority when working with lighting equipment in industrial environments. Ensure all electrical connections are secure and that equipment is properly grounded to prevent electrical hazards. Be mindful of potential trip hazards from cables and stands, and clearly mark these areas to prevent accidents. When using powerful strobes, be aware of the potential for eye damage and take necessary precautions. Communicate clearly with on-site personnel regarding safety protocols and ensure everyone is aware of the potential hazards associated with lighting equipment. By prioritizing safety and implementing proper procedures, you can create a safe and productive working environment for yourself and others.

Composition and Framing for Impact

Strong composition and framing are essential for creating impactful industrial photographs. These techniques guide the viewer’s eye, emphasizing key elements and conveying the narrative effectively. Understanding and applying fundamental compositional principles can transform ordinary industrial scenes into captivating visuals.

Leverage leading lines—pipes, conveyor belts, railway tracks—to draw the viewer’s gaze deeper into the image. These lines create a sense of depth and direct attention to the focal point. Utilize the rule of thirds, placing key elements off-center to create a more balanced and dynamic composition. Experiment with different angles and perspectives to find unique viewpoints that highlight the industrial environment’s scale and complexity. Shooting from low angles can emphasize the imposing size of machinery, while high angles provide a comprehensive overview of the scene.

Framing within the frame can add depth and context. Use architectural elements, machinery components, or even light and shadow to create natural frames that highlight the subject. Consider the use of negative space—the empty areas surrounding the subject—to create a sense of isolation and emphasize the subject’s form and scale. This technique is particularly effective in highlighting the stark beauty of industrial structures and machinery.

Symmetry and patterns are often found in industrial settings. Recognize and utilize these elements to create visually compelling compositions. The repetition of shapes and lines can create a sense of order and rhythm, while symmetrical compositions can evoke a sense of balance and stability. However, don’t be afraid to break the symmetry or introduce an element of asymmetry to add visual interest and prevent the image from becoming too static.

Context is crucial in industrial photography. Include elements that provide a sense of scale and location. A worker interacting with machinery, a tool resting on a workbench, or a distant cityscape visible through a factory window can add depth and narrative to the image. These details help the viewer understand the environment and connect with the story being told. By carefully considering composition and framing, you can transform ordinary industrial scenes into powerful visual narratives that capture the essence of industry and engage the viewer on a deeper level. Remember that these techniques are tools to enhance your storytelling, not rigid rules. Experiment and find what works best for each unique situation.

Post-Processing and Editing

Post-processing is an integral part of industrial photography, allowing you to refine your images and enhance their visual impact. While the goal is never to manipulate reality, careful editing can bring out the inherent beauty and drama of industrial scenes. This stage involves both global adjustments, affecting the entire image, and localized edits focusing on specific areas.

Start with basic adjustments like exposure, contrast, and white balance. Correcting these elements ensures a balanced and accurate representation of the scene. Fine-tune highlights and shadows to reveal details and create depth. Adjusting clarity can enhance textures and add a sense of grit, while vibrance can bring out the richness of colors without oversaturation. Be subtle in your adjustments, aiming for a natural and believable look.

Sharpening is crucial for highlighting the intricate details of machinery and textures. However, avoid over-sharpening, which can introduce unwanted artifacts and make the image appear unnatural. Noise reduction can be helpful, especially in images shot in low-light conditions. Address any lens distortions or chromatic aberrations to ensure a technically sound image. These corrections contribute to a professional and polished final product.

Consider targeted adjustments using localized editing tools. Dodge and burn techniques can further refine highlights and shadows, adding depth and dimension. Clone stamping or healing tools can be used to remove distracting elements or imperfections, ensuring a clean and focused image. However, use these tools judiciously to maintain the integrity of the scene.

Color grading can enhance the mood and atmosphere of your industrial photographs. Experiment with different color palettes to evoke specific emotions or create a stylistic look. However, maintain consistency within a series of images and avoid overly stylized effects that detract from the subject matter. The ultimate goal of post-processing is to enhance, not overpower, the inherent qualities of your photographs. By approaching editing with a thoughtful and balanced approach, you can create impactful industrial images that effectively communicate your vision and capture the essence of the industrial world.

Choosing the Right Equipment

Selecting the right equipment is crucial for successful industrial photography. Your gear should be robust, versatile, and capable of handling the demanding conditions often encountered in industrial environments. From cameras and lenses to lighting and support equipment, each component plays a vital role in capturing high-quality images.

A sturdy DSLR or mirrorless camera with a high dynamic range is essential for capturing the wide range of tones often found in industrial settings. A full-frame sensor is generally preferred for its superior low-light performance and shallow depth of field capabilities. However, a crop-sensor camera can also be effective, especially when paired with appropriate lenses. Consider weather-sealed bodies for added protection against dust, moisture, and other environmental factors.

Lens selection depends on the specific needs of the shoot. Wide-angle lenses are ideal for capturing expansive views of industrial facilities and machinery. Prime lenses with wide apertures, such as a 24mm or 35mm, are excellent choices for low-light situations and achieving shallow depth of field. Telephoto lenses allow you to isolate specific details and compress perspective, creating a sense of depth and scale. A tilt-shift lens can be invaluable for correcting perspective distortions and achieving precise control over focus.

A sturdy tripod is essential for maintaining stability, particularly in low-light conditions or when using long exposures. A ball head allows for quick and precise adjustments, while a geared head provides finer control for critical compositions. Remote shutter release helps eliminate camera shake and ensures sharp images. Consider a robust carrying case to protect your equipment during transport.

Lighting equipment, such as strobes and flashes, are often necessary to supplement existing light and control the mood of your images. Light modifiers, like softboxes and umbrellas, help diffuse light and soften shadows. Reflectors can be used to bounce light back into the scene, filling in shadows and creating a more even illumination. Choose lighting equipment that is durable and reliable, capable of withstanding the rigors of industrial environments. Careful selection of equipment, combined with a thorough understanding of its capabilities, empowers you to capture stunning industrial photographs that effectively communicate your vision and meet the demands of professional publications.
